Section 1: Disaster Response and Recovery

One of the most critical applications of GIS programming is in disaster response and recovery. By analyzing satellite imagery and geographic data, emergency responders can quickly identify areas of damage, prioritize response efforts, and allocate resources more effectively. For example, during Hurricane Harvey in 2017, GIS analysts used satellite imagery to identify flooded areas and create maps that helped emergency responders navigate the affected regions. This not only saved lives but also reduced the economic impact of the disaster. Section 2: Urban Planning and Development

GIS programming is also widely used in urban planning and development. By analyzing geographic data, urban planners can identify areas of high population density, traffic congestion, and environmental degradation. This information can be used to inform urban planning decisions, such as the location of new transportation infrastructure, public facilities, and residential developments. For instance, the city of Barcelona used GIS analysis to identify areas of high population density and developed a bike-sharing program to reduce traffic congestion and promote sustainable transportation. Section 3: Environmental Conservation

Another significant application of GIS programming is in environmental conservation. By analyzing geographic data, conservationists can identify areas of high conservation value, track changes in land use and land cover, and monitor the impact of human activities on the environment. For example, the World Wildlife Fund (WWF) used GIS analysis to identify areas of high conservation value in the Amazon rainforest and developed a conservation plan to protect these areas from deforestation and habitat fragmentation.
